--- Erik Hofman <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ote: > David Megginson wrote: > > > The only inconsistency left is gear position: > > > > JSBSim: /gear/gear[n]/position > > YASim: /gear/gear[n]/position-norm > > > > They both agree on using 1.0 for down and 0.0 for > up, though, and > > that's good news. As soon as this last problem is > fixed, I'll switch > > the animations over and we'll have smooth flap and > gear movement. In > > fact, if the FDM people want to get really clever, > they can have the > > gear retract and extend slightly out of sync so > that they lock up or > > down about .5 sec apart.
